The Wichita Eagle newspaper released the fourth official track for the 2026 edition of Eagle Medallion Hunt. The new guidance was published on Sunday, May 31, 2026, at exactly 6:31 pm local time. The Eagle Staff team structured Pista 4 with two short, direct sentences designed to test participants’ perception. The opening text states that the entire city knows the answer to the first question. The formulation indicates that the solution in the initial stage depends on knowledge widely shared by the local community, discarding obscure theories or difficult-to-access data. The second part of the message provides specific physical instruction for hunters in the field. The organization directs the public to look down toward the medallion while considering the source. The guideline suggests that the item sought rests near ground level, possibly camouflaged in vegetation, buried shallowly, or attached to the base of some structure. The change in visual perspective alters the way groups inspect public spaces. Muitos participants tend to focus on tall monuments or road signs, ignoring the details present in the pavement or earth.

The mention of the term “source” opens up a range of interpretative possibilities for amateur researchers. The word can indicate a decorative water structure, the origin of historical data, a specific geographic landmark in the region or even the name of a street. The Eagle Medallion Hunt regulations establish strict parameters for participants’ behavior during the search weeks. The competition’s official website details eligibility rules, hours allowed for exploration and access restrictions in conservation areas. The organization strictly prohibits the invasion of private properties, deep excavation in public gardens and the vandalism of historical heritage. The 2026 edition of Eagle Medallion Hunt runs parallel to the extensive Wichita Riverfest lineup. The festival is among the biggest cultural celebrations in the region, boosting the local economy and attracting thousands of visitors from neighboring cities every year. The hunt functions as an interactive extension activity that moves the public outside the event’s main gates, decentralizing the flow of tourists.
